When to Replace Entry Door Locks

Replacing your entry door locks is required in numerous circumstances:

  1. Lost Keys: If you've misplaced your secrets, unauthorized people might access to your home if they find them.
  2. Break-Ins: After a break-in, it's essential to change your locks to prevent additional events.
  3. Moving into a New Home: New locals must constantly change locks, as previous residents may still have gain access to.
  4. Used Locks: Over time, exposure to the components can trigger locks to wear. If your locks are challenging to turn or stick, replacement is suggested.
  5. Updating Security: Perhaps your home has an older lock system that does not meet current security requirements. Updating supplies better security.

Types of Entry Door Locks

When changing an entry door lock, it is important to consider the different choices offered. Each lock type has different security features and levels of ease of usage.

Deadbolts

  • Single Cylinder Deadbolt: A crucial operates the outdoors, whereas a thumb turn permits entry from within, offering simpleness but less security versus break-ins.
  • Double Cylinder Deadbolt: Requires a secret for both the exterior and interior; while it uses boosted security, it may posture a safety concern in emergencies.

Smart Locks

Smart locks can use keyless entry through mobile gadgets or fingerprint recognition. They're perfect for tech-savvy house owners however may require charging or battery replacement.

Knob Locks

While visually pleasing and typically effective, knob locks are frequently considered less secure than other choices and must always be paired with a deadbolt.

Lever Handle Locks

These locks are simpler to run, especially for those with movement issues. Similar to knob locks, they also do not have robust security features when utilized alone.

Mortise Locks

All-in-one units that house the lock and lever/knob mechanism. They supply great security however require more comprehensive installation.

Upkeep Tips for Entry Door Locks

After replacing your entry door locks, it's important to keep them to make sure longevity and functionality.

  • Routine Lubrication: Use graphite or silicone-based lube on lock mechanisms to avoid locking problems.
  • Inspect for Wear and Tear: Regularly examine your locks for any indications of degeneration. Replace them as necessary.
  • Keep Keys in Good Condition: Avoid bending or hoarding old keys, as they can cause wear and tear on the lock.

Often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. How much does it cost to replace entry door locks?

The cost can vary from ₤ 20 for an easy knob lock to over ₤ 300 for smart locks or high-grade deadbolts, plus any labor costs if you employ a professional.

2. Can I change my locks myself?

Yes, replacing locks can usually be done by a property owner with standard tools and mechanical inclination. However, speaking with a professional is wise if not sure of the lock type or installation process.

3. How frequently should I change my locks?

It is smart to evaluate your locks every few years, but replace them instantly if you experience any significant modifications like losing keys or if there has actually been a burglary.

4. Are smart locks reliable?

Smart locks typically supply better security than standard locks, however their reliability can depend on the specific design and correct upkeep of batteries and electrical parts.

5. What should I do if I lock myself out?

In such situations, it's suggested to call a locksmith professional. Trying to force a lock can cause damage that may require changing the lock entirely.
